- The distance between Hama, Syria and Ruoqiang, China is approximately 4,522 km or 2,810 mi.
- To reach Hama in this distance one would set out from Ruoqiang bearing 281.1° or W and follow the great circles arc to approach Hama bearing 248.7° or WSW .
- Hama has a Mediterranean hot climate (Csa) whereas Ruoqiang has a mid-latitude cool desert climate (BWk).
- Hama is in or near the subtropical thorn woodland biome whereas Ruoqiang is in or near the cool temperate steppe biome.
- The annual average temperature is 6 °C (10.8°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 13.4 °C (24.1°F) less in Hama.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to truly continental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 327.7 mm (12.9 in) more which is equivalent to 327.7 l/m² (8.04 US gal/ft²) or 3,277,000 l/ha (350,333 US gal/ac) more. About 14 1/9 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 3.9° higher in Hama than in Ruoqiang.
